Default Experience w/ Kenwood DNX7100 by Nav newbie

I started this process thinking I'd get a Garmin 650 or the like and mount it in the cubby (there's a thread on this). Simple, straightforward, affordable.

But reading thru a lot of other threads on Nav solutions, I gravitated toward a more elaborate solution: the Kenwood DNX7100.

Long story short, I went w/ the Kenwood and am VERY happy I did.

I bought the unit from cartronixplus for $925, incl an iPod adapter and shipping. Some risk, as others have mentioned, since you don't have the factory warranty. But a savings of $400 over some other vendors clinched it. As it turned out, they were great to deal with, and the unit arrived as promised.

For the install, I went to Street Sound Plus in the L.A. area, per the suggestion of someone on this board. Price: $200, incl whatever harness and mounting adapters were required for the 350Z. No fuss installation and they set up the nav and took time to walk me thru the system's features. Plan to go back to them for a speaker upgrade in the near future. Highly recommended for those who don't feel qualified to do installs themselves.

The system looks great and works flawlessly. My only criticism is the menus/command organization. It's pretty badly designed, making it a PITA to access some functions. But I'll figure it out in time.
